Transaction 037704c20ecd76ecbe692ca630341b09b3ed2db637611b477a8a045e8cc6ed08

2 Input
2 Outputs
  • 037704c20ecd76ecbe692ca630341b09b3ed2db637611b477a8a045e8cc6ed08:0
  • value  11724900
    address  1KAj93PTnAEdkiAXACd6kP4g7fJk83ipch
  • 037704c20ecd76ecbe692ca630341b09b3ed2db637611b477a8a045e8cc6ed08:1
  • value  177449
    address  13ZhPLvUbSnoiDwDhYRk5HTavENU4VUaE6